Use case
Marketing teams need repeatable prompt systems for campaign briefs, messaging, research, content outlines, and creative exploration. A shared prompt workspace keeps those workflows organized and reusable.
Keep brand voice and output structure aligned across campaigns, channels, and contributors.
Test messaging and prompt variations without losing track of what changed.
Turn strong prompts into reusable systems that the whole marketing team can build on.
Campaign work usually includes repeated patterns: positioning, audience variants, content formats, and review loops. A prompt workspace helps marketing teams turn those patterns into reusable systems.
When a team shares prompt logic instead of copying it through chats and notes, output quality becomes easier to maintain. That matters for tone, compliance, and production speed.
Use boards to structure campaign prompts, connect them to data inputs, and review output quality together. That helps marketing teams keep AI work visible and repeatable.
